Ingredients

  • 1 bunchyoung asparagus (chopped)
  • 3/4 cupdry orzo (cooked according to package instructions)
  • 1 canbutter beans (drained and rinsed)
  • 1/2 cupgreen olives (pitted and roughly chopped)
  • 6-7artichoke hearts (halved)
  • 1/2 cupparsley (finely minced)
  • 1/2 cupdill (finely minced)
  • 1/4 cuplemon juice
  • 1/4 cupextra virgin olive oil
  • 2 tbsphoney
  • 2 tsplemon zest (about 1 lemon)
  • 1 clovegarlic (finely minced or grated)
  • 1 tspfreshly cracked black pepper

Instructions

  1. 1

    Preheat your oven to 450°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

  2. 2

    Rinse the asparagus and chop into small pieces. Add to the baking sheet, drizzle with olive oil and salt, and toss to coat.

  3. 3

    Bake the asparagus for 20-25 minutes until browned and slightly charred.

  4. 4

    Cook the orzo according to package instructions, making sure to salt the pasta water.

  5. 5

    Add butter beans, olives, artichoke hearts, parsley, and dill to a large serving bowl. Once the asparagus and orzo are done, add them to the bowl.

  6. 6

    In a saucepan, combine all vinaigrette ingredients and heat on medium-high while whisking. Once frothy, take off heat.

  7. 7

    Pour the vinaigrette over the bowl and toss to combine. Let sit for 5-10 minutes before serving.
